Commit Graph

  • ab7dff679e Add basic phone role IT'S HABBENING :DDDDD Salt 2020-09-04 09:08:00 -0500
  • 9b332e2e1b Remove remove legacy cronjob Salt 2020-09-04 07:44:54 -0500
  • d30b5bcf65 Revert "That's supposed to be a password hash I guess" Salt 2020-09-04 07:39:50 -0500
  • 4a066e2492 Replace the right user_password Salt 2020-09-04 07:39:40 -0500
  • fe557f8e9a Merge branch 'master' of git.9iron.club:salt/ansible Salt 2020-09-04 07:34:02 -0500
  • 0394a12bdf That's supposed to be a password hash I guess Salt 2020-09-04 07:33:56 -0500
  • b489ce7ed9 Merge branch 'master' of git.9iron.club:salt/ansible into master Salt 2020-09-04 07:28:34 -0500
  • 0369b71a8c Add different user password for phones I'm not gonna say it's numeric but it's numeric Salt 2020-09-04 07:26:55 -0500
  • 12f9f1254b Add phone playbook for Zerotier Salt 2020-09-04 07:15:22 -0500
  • fcd64b1eb1 Fix typo in base-user Salt 2020-09-04 07:05:54 -0500
  • d43e0b8426 How about we just get rid of unattended-upgrades instead of disabling it? Salt 2020-09-04 06:55:10 -0500
  • 7a955f85cf Add libffi-dev to required packages in localhost-deploy Weird, it's installed by default on Ubuntu but not in Mobian Salt 2020-09-04 06:37:31 -0500
  • d73ce5cbd8 Check for distro family, not distro specifically A lot of these Just Werk on Debian Salt 2020-09-04 06:16:30 -0500
  • 0f04972209 Add pmbootstrap Salt 2020-09-03 18:31:08 -0500
  • 4550f1bb04 APPEND the group, APPEND IT Salt 2020-09-02 22:49:46 -0500
  • 62fad4cd94 Bump timeout on ipify-facts Salt 2020-09-02 22:38:05 -0500
  • 848d07f70f Don't try to add user to sudo unconditionally Salt 2020-09-02 22:24:44 -0500
  • 8cc22ac56f Add user to sudo or wheel Salt 2020-09-02 22:21:07 -0500
  • 4178990345 Fix erroneous OS condition check Salt 2020-09-02 22:12:47 -0500
  • 02f06efdcd Add acl tool Ran into that dumb bug again Salt 2020-09-02 22:09:47 -0500
  • e87d3b0f35 Add more package to ansible role on Alpine Salt 2020-09-02 22:04:17 -0500
  • 4b543de41e Qualify some more ansible and ansible-puull related stuff Salt 2020-09-02 22:01:31 -0500
  • af1d6d7905 Assign Ansible user a group based on distro Salt 2020-09-02 21:57:46 -0500
  • 08f7947d4d More restrictive tasks Salt 2020-09-02 21:54:33 -0500
  • edfd755ebd Actually we'll add a special case for PMOS/Alpine Salt 2020-09-02 18:44:58 -0500
  • 2b81b85ccb Make hostname module condition more clear Salt 2020-09-02 18:42:11 -0500
  • 1633a0bc3e Apparently this breaks on PMOS Salt 2020-09-02 18:40:25 -0500
  • c57708ccb2 Add some more packages for a PMOS bootstrap Salt 2020-09-02 18:36:30 -0500
  • 86ada4aa3d Update and upgrade apk packages Salt 2020-09-02 18:15:57 -0500
  • cfcf91a010 Qualify most of common by distro Salt 2020-09-02 18:12:10 -0500
  • 5df58a3b5d Add error handler for install script Salt 2020-09-02 18:03:41 -0500
  • f963f1866c Correct wrong package manager for previous commit whups Salt 2020-09-02 18:03:01 -0500
  • 975b2ea938 Add clause in localhost-deploy to use apk if found Salt 2020-09-02 17:47:03 -0500
  • e09604540d Add role for phone Salt 2020-09-02 17:41:21 -0500
  • f840d432be Add phone key to all systems Salt 2020-09-02 17:11:30 -0500
  • 1c1894ed72 Add phone to inventory Not like it's gonna do much right now Salt 2020-09-02 17:07:16 -0500
  • 645a930d64 Merge branch 'master' of git.9iron.club:salt/ansible Salt 2020-08-31 21:03:04 -0500
  • af2dc2332d Have telegraf monitor systemd units Salt 2020-08-31 21:02:12 -0500
  • 15e61e8612 Remove influxdb-client This is installed by the new influxdb package Salt 2020-08-31 01:54:18 -0500
  • 535d1b4929 Make sure services are enabled and started Salt 2020-08-31 01:46:48 -0500
  • 1982326553 Move telegraf to its own role Salt 2020-08-30 19:35:18 -0500
  • b26fb5d741 Have Matrix install for the right distro by default Salt 2020-08-28 17:07:14 -0500
  • c7b0cc7892 Correct package name on Pleroma Salt 2020-08-28 16:21:33 -0500
  • 560f4c8e5f Add apt-file to basic utils Salt 2020-08-28 16:15:07 -0500
  • 82c78e092e Increase TTLs on DNS records to 3600s (from 300s) I'm fairly confident in the stability of my record sets now that I've done most of the experimentation Salt 2020-08-27 17:40:53 -0500
  • ddd8195e17 Set up email for Grafana Salt 2020-08-25 13:19:51 -0500
  • ed64d3a005 Set GRUB_RECORDFAIL_TIMEOUT https://ubuntuforums.org/showthread.php?t=2412153 Apparently this only happens on systems that have: * UEFI on * LVM * Exactly one OS For some reason, generator scripts will FORCE GRUB to bail to menu with a 30 second fucking timeout in this case This is like the number one install method, too. What the fuck. Salt 2020-08-25 03:28:04 -0500
  • 76ea3ce514 Work on GRUB configs Salt 2020-08-25 03:11:23 -0500
  • a872a62bca Work on Plymouth Salt 2020-08-25 03:05:11 -0500
  • 0b3d783c1f Add GRUB configs Salt 2020-08-25 02:32:04 -0500
  • c0f4f6fcb7 Also actually remove them remove them Salt 2020-08-25 02:25:16 -0500
  • 2a27495652 Remove legacy sessions Salt 2020-08-25 02:24:57 -0500
  • 83ce4d9e91 Update tes3mp configs Salt 2020-08-24 00:59:54 -0500
  • d23c052403 Update config.lua Salt 2020-08-24 00:16:52 -0500
  • 2e6690450f Template out config.lua, too Salt 2020-08-24 00:10:57 -0500
  • 1b7961546e Put configs in the right place Salt 2020-08-23 23:52:46 -0500
  • 4f0e6f22d8 Fix incorrect unit binary path Salt 2020-08-23 23:40:24 -0500
  • f1b08ee635 Restart tes3mp on unit change Salt 2020-08-23 23:39:01 -0500
  • 968255ab76 Add packages, simplify systemd unit Salt 2020-08-23 23:38:01 -0500
  • 5c32a14c19 Do configuration as tes3mp user Salt 2020-08-23 23:36:20 -0500
  • 43e089dd90 Add more explicit vars to tes3mp config Salt 2020-08-23 23:30:53 -0500
  • 85ecd8fa68 Add TES3MP server Salt 2020-08-23 23:12:39 -0500
  • dccb7419ac Merge branch 'master' of git.9iron.club:salt/ansible Salt 2020-08-23 22:41:20 -0500
  • 75eb36d084 Add Adam packages Salt 2020-08-23 22:41:13 -0500
  • 079eb24de1 Pleroma: Enable in-db configs Salt 2020-08-23 20:25:47 -0500
  • 8e2d11adad Revert SDDM 99x11-common_start workaround thing Salt 2020-08-23 19:28:51 -0500
  • b71dd77a59 Reboot machines in a less-destructive order Salt 2020-08-23 01:15:18 -0500
  • a443cbb297 Fix Nextcloud backup script incorrect perms Salt 2020-08-22 23:44:23 -0500
  • e0011646a0 Only restart Ansible on failure whups Salt 2020-08-19 04:48:02 -0500
  • 1d623bfed1 Configure ansible-pull.service to restart on failure up to 5 times an hour Salt 2020-08-18 10:02:13 -0500
  • b638c1aad0 Change repo for root website Salt 2020-08-16 07:08:05 -0500
  • 94e35ccbb7 Don't take a DB backup for a DB that doesn't exist, Nextcloud Salt 2020-08-15 16:02:28 -0500
  • 2a1299e9e0 Move Gitea to Postgres Migration is nontrivial and SUCKS DICK but whatever Salt 2020-08-15 16:01:56 -0500
  • 7c506157f7 Fix setting up a Mysql db that shouldn't exist Salt 2020-08-15 15:43:50 -0500
  • 31d9aac7ef Move Nextcloud to PostgreSQL Salt 2020-08-15 15:33:02 -0500
  • af9596d9f0 Move backups to absolute time Salt 2020-08-15 14:48:11 -0500
  • 3866fa159d Fix mount not actually being a mount task Salt 2020-08-15 05:54:22 -0500
  • 6e9af61025 Add new root directory to Gitea Salt 2020-08-15 05:51:24 -0500
  • 590741d001 Rename Gitea root directory Salt 2020-08-15 05:51:05 -0500
  • d5c1d838e4 Add EFS configuration to Gitea Salt 2020-08-15 05:49:43 -0500
  • 04b8738435 Add EFS support to Gitea Salt 2020-08-15 05:47:18 -0500
  • 11bb70b522 Move backups on web1 back into / Salt 2020-08-15 05:31:39 -0500
  • bdaaf1336f Move Nextcloud to an EFS mount Salt 2020-08-15 05:11:50 -0500
  • a32c7f575a Decom a really old box Salt 2020-08-13 20:36:41 -0500
  • c7e26795b0 Add mozc-utils-gui to packageset This was installed as a recommend on 19.10 but not on 20.04 I guess Salt 2020-08-11 05:18:38 -0500
  • 2ca99cac3f Switch to OnCalendar for ansible pull setups Salt 2020-08-11 03:51:15 -0500
  • 33242616ca Use new bootstrap script Salt 2020-08-10 23:38:08 -0500
  • bab99ac0a9 Add Carson's website Salt 2020-08-10 20:15:35 -0500
  • e2b0cafa1e Add config for touchpads Salt 2020-08-10 19:14:20 -0500
  • 2557368a45 Add libinput-tools Salt 2020-08-10 17:33:42 -0500
  • 48a255406f Hey that's not a request header Salt 2020-08-10 14:25:58 -0500
  • f4f1b58b8b Unset XFO in Gitea vhost Salt 2020-08-10 14:19:40 -0500
  • b86eee2f0b Remove dep on apache AUUGH Salt 2020-08-10 06:43:08 -0500
  • 06bcbafc86 Remove Apache from desktops FUCKING WHY Salt 2020-08-10 06:38:46 -0500
  • 2ce3297f4e Only run influxdb on aws boxes Salt 2020-08-10 06:24:22 -0500
  • 5ed134fc66 Add vpnc and kamoso Salt 2020-08-09 07:25:27 -0500
  • 3f419f8e6e Fix more incorrect roles Salt 2020-08-08 20:38:14 -0500
  • 0faa20d3e5 Rename a bunch of roles Salt 2020-08-08 20:37:28 -0500
  • 4cf2380ac0 Add material design icons dx Salt 2020-08-08 07:32:21 -0500
  • 5afa860744 Add mono-complete Salt 2020-08-08 00:10:35 -0500